Transaction ea889c326bcf4f14f959a3f99566c2319e62a36405db4cf5fcde961c5c3ee470

block
426a1a2c6402a9207ac4bd9dcf351afd018c9a0f4fb015bdf99dadc69b72b6a6

1 Input

31 Outputs